Following a software engineer’s tragic drowning in a waterlogged trench, Uttar Pradesh’s Chief Minister has taken serious notice. Lokesh M, CEO of Noida Authority, has been removed, and an SIT formed to investigate the incident. The victim’s car plunged into the trench at a hazardous, unmarked turn in Sector 150, with rescue efforts critically delayed.
